Kids Cook!
offers a hands-on cooking experience especially designed for children.
Kids learn how to measure, mix, grate, peel, cut, and whip; how to
knead dough for bread, and how to roll it for pastries and pasta. All
cooking is done with fresh, natural ingredients and seasonal produce. Fall,
winter, and spring sessions are available during the school year, and
special seminars are offered in summer. Afterschool classes meet once a
week for eight weeks. Kids receive take-home portions and recipes for
all dishes prepared in class. Classes are limited to eight children, with two adult instructors.

"Pint-size cooks can learn to make dim sum, sopas and baba ghanouj. On a recent weekend, Alyssa Volland, the instructor and the wife of Alex Volland, the restaurant's owner and chef, chose pizza for the day's lesson. But this wasnât a typical child-friendly pizza â frozen, on a bagel or dripping with pepperoni. Instead, Hanna Mandel, 5, set to mixing yeast pebbles, sea salt and extra virgin olive oil into an artisanal dough, which she topped with mozzarella and a nutty, slightly stinky Gruyère before choosing a vegetable topping. As she kneaded, she talked about her No. 1 food, sushi, declaring, âSeaweed is my favorite part.â"
-New York Times
